Introduction to Saltpeter
Saltpeter, with the chemical formula KNO3, is a naturally occurring mineral that can be found in various parts of the world. It is a key component of gunpowder, which has been used for centuries in firearms and explosives. Saltpeter is also used in the production of fertilizers, as it is a rich source of nitrogen, an essential nutrient for plant growth. Additionally, it has been used as a food preservative, particularly in the curing of meats, due to its ability to inhibit the growth of bacteria.
History of Saltpeter Use
The use of saltpeter dates back to ancient times, with evidence of its application in China, India, and Europe. In the Middle Ages, saltpeter was a highly valued commodity, as it was a crucial ingredient in the production of gunpowder. The search for saltpeter deposits became a significant aspect of international trade and diplomacy, with countries competing to secure access to this vital resource. The history of saltpeter is a testament to its importance and versatility, with its uses extending beyond the military to include agriculture, food preservation, and even medicine.
Saltpeter in Food Preservation
One of the most significant uses of saltpeter in the food industry is as a preservative. It has been used for centuries to cure meats, such as bacon and ham, by drawing out moisture and preventing the growth of bacteria. Saltpeter also helps to add flavor and texture to cured meats, making it a valuable ingredient in the production of these products. What is saltpeter and where is it commonly found?
Saltpeter, also known as potassium nitrate, is a naturally occurring mineral compound that has been used for various purposes throughout history. It is commonly found in soil, caves, and rocky areas, particularly in regions with high levels of nitrogen-rich organic matter. Saltpeter can also be produced synthetically through the reaction of potassium chloride and nitric acid. In its natural form, saltpeter appears as a white or colorless crystalline substance that is highly soluble in water.
The presence of saltpeter in the environment has led to its use in various applications, including agriculture, medicine, and food preservation. For example, saltpeter has been used as a fertilizer to promote plant growth and as a preservative to extend the shelf life of meats and other food products. How is saltpeter used in food preservation and what are the benefits?
Saltpeter has been used for centuries as a food preservative, particularly in the production of cured meats such as bacon and ham. The preservative properties of saltpeter are due to its ability to inhibit the growth of bacteria and other microorganisms, which can cause spoilage and foodborne illness. Saltpeter works by releasing nitric oxide, which combines with the myoglobin in meat to form a stable complex that prevents the growth of microorganisms. This process also gives cured meats their characteristic pink color and flavor.
The use of saltpeter in food preservation has several benefits, including extending the shelf life of food products, reducing the risk of foodborne illness, and enhancing the flavor and texture of cured meats.
